How it works for Kitchen on Fire
Three steps to pull scattered guest feedback into one inbox and act on what matters.
Connect your channels
Link the review sites you use and add a table QR. Online reviews and in-restaurant feedback flow into one Dishcus inbox.
Read it all in one list
See every comment in one place, with statistics and guest insights on ratings, recurring themes, and what guests praise or want improved.
Reply and follow up
Draft replies you can edit before you post, then follow up on feedback that needs your team while it is still fresh.
